**Mgmt Meeting Minutes — Retiring the Brightline Range**

Quick recap for sales leads at Fenholt Supplies: we agreed to retire the Brightline fixture range by year-end. Remaining stock moves to clearance pricing next month, and accounts on standing orders get migrated to the Lumetta range. Trade-in incentives were approved in principle. The confidential note on next steps sits just below.

board note of bajof-bajeg: The pricing group signed off on a budget of $13.4 million for Project Sildor. The renewal with Lamixek Holdings closes at $48.9 million a year, 49 percent above the last contract.

// Broker upgrade notes for plugin authors:
// Quillbus 4.x replaces the legacy 3.x wire protocol. Plugins must
// construct the client with explicit protocol negotiation enabled,
// or connections to the Larkfield cluster will be silently downgraded
// and dropped after 30s. Topic names are unchanged. For local testing
// against the sandbox broker, authenticate with the key below.

API key for bafof-bagaf: qvz2-qi

## 4.2.0 — Changed defaults

The nightly search reindex in Quillbase now runs incrementally by default instead of a full rebuild. Full rebuilds are weekly (Sunday) only. Expect shorter maintenance windows and fresher results on weekday mornings. If customers report stale results, trigger a manual full reindex before escalating. The shipped defaults for the reindex service are as follows.

settings of tagef-bawif:
DRUIX_HOST=druix.zemvarlabs.internal
DRUIX_PORT=8000

Subject: On-call notes — tenant quotas

Welcome aboard. One area that trips people up: per-tenant rate quotas in the Harrowgate gateway. Quotas are enforced per tenant, per endpoint class, with a sliding one-minute window; bursts above quota return a retryable status, so clients may recover silently. Never raise a quota manually during an incident without recording the change — future maintainers must be able to reconstruct why. The full quota table and change procedure live here.

wiki page, bagaf-fawip: https://harbor.tolvaqsys.local/pages/repo/pages/secrets/eac969ffc71f356b